Holy Books

There are many types of sacred books in this religion. The Vedas, which are said to be the essence of life, are considered very popular and sacred among the Hindus. It is considered to be a very ancient text written in Sanskrit language. There are 4 types of Vedas available in Hinduism:

1. Yajurveda
2. Atharva Veda
3. Samaveda
4. Rigveda.

Also, texts like Bhagwat Gita, Upanishad, Purana, Ramayana, Mahabharata etc. are sacred books of Hindus. The Bhagavad Gita, which describes the essence of life or the way of living, is the same book that is being read in schools and colleges in Europe and America today.
